Association Of Polymorphisms Of Klotho Gene With Low Bone Mineral Density In Elderly People

Objective:To acknowledge the association of polymorphisms of klotho gene with low bone mineral density in elderly Uyghur and Han people, and explore the distribution differences of polymorphisms of the gene in ethnic people. Methods:The study adopts a case-control method. A total of324elderly Uyghur and Han patients (≥60years old) were selected from cadre wards of the First Affiliated Hospital of Xinjiang Medical University between October2011and August2013.Lexos dual energy X-ray absorptiometry (DEXA, DMS Co. Ltd, France) was used to check BMD (bone mineral density) of lumbar spine and hip. All the patients were divided into the low BMD case group and control one. Genotype of klotho G395A and F352V polymorphisms were done by multiplex SNaPshot reaction. Results:(1)Both of SNP exist polymorphisms. The distributions of gene polymorphisms in Uyghur and Han people accord with Hardy-Weinberg equilibrium.(2) In case and control groups, the distributions of klotho gene polymorphisms are no statistically significant difference (P>0.05). Overall comparison between the Uygur and Han people, the distribution of G395A polymorphisms is no significant difference (P>0.05); While the TT genotype and T allele frequencies are lower in Uygur national minority than Han crowd (P<0.05), and the TG and GG genotype and G allele frequencies are higher in Han (P<0.05). The diffusions of klotho gene polymorphisms in male and female are no difference (P>0.05).(3) Logistic regression analysis displays that the klotho gene polymorphisms are not associated with low BMD, and female and hypertension are the independent risk factors that affects BMD. Conclusion:G395A and F352V polymorphisms of klotho gene are not associated with low BMD; and the distribution of F352V polymorphisms in Uyghur and Han people exists differences.
